This wonderful condition A 2 flight jacket belonged to 2nd Lieutenant George Roger Cohan who flew a Lockheed P 38 Lightning during World War Two as a member of the 337th Fighter Squadron, 3rd Air Force. The 337th Fighter Squadron was activated in 1942 in Keflavik, Iceland, equipped with Lockheed P 38 Lightnings.
